Uniformity bill moves forward

The House Energy and Commerce Committee has voted out the National Uniformity for Food Act (H.R. 4167) that provides uniform, national standards and warning requirements for food labeling, advertising, and other communications by food companies.

The bill, which had bipartisan support, now goes to the House floor for a vote.

Similar legislation is expected to be introduced in the Senate. Some states and consumer groups oppose the measure which, they say, undercuts state and local authority and weakens consumer protections.
